Synthesizing Sustainability and Digital to Boost Performance

The convergence of sustainability and digital transformation has become a powerful catalyst for enhancing business performance across industries. As organizations face mounting pressure to reduce environmental impact while maintaining a competitive edge, integrating sustainability with digital technologies offers a path to achieve both ecological responsibility and operational excellence.
Digital Transformation as a Driver
Digital technologies, such as IoT, AI, and blockchain, play a pivotal role in enabling sustainable practices. These tools enhance visibility into operations, allowing businesses to track energy usage, monitor emissions, and optimize resource consumption in real time.
By integrating digital solutions, companies can improve resource efficiency throughout their supply chains. AI-driven analytics enable precise forecasting of demand, reducing overproduction and minimizing waste.

ESG Reporting and Digital Solutions
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) reporting has become critical for businesses to demonstrate accountability. Digital platforms streamline ESG data collection, analysis, and reporting, ensuring compliance with global standards.
AI algorithms can also identify trends and risks, helping companies proactively address potential sustainability gaps.
Innovation through Sustainable Product Design
Digital tools enable innovation in sustainable product design, helping companies create offerings that minimize environmental impact. Advanced simulation technologies allow engineers to design products with lower material usage and improved energy efficiency.
Digital prototyping reduces the need for physical iterations, accelerating development cycles and conserving resources.
